Ordinals
beta
Sat 837670699325822
decimal
167534.699325822
degree
0°167534′206″699325822‴
percentile
39.88908096415524%
name
hxlvewefcbr
cycle
0
epoch
0
period
83
block
167534
offset
699325822
timestamp
2012-02-19 16:13:22 UTC
rarity
common
prev
next